Sludge scrapers/suction machines, also known as mobile scrapers, are specialized equipment used for wastewater treatment and for removing settled sludge from sedimentation tanks. These machines typically consist of a bridge that spans the tank, a drive unit, a suction system to collect the sludge, and a skimmer to remove surface debris. The collected sludge is then transported out of the tank, effectively cleaning the bottom and improving water quality.
The DZBX series single (full) peripheral drive sludge scraping/suction machine (thickener) is commonly used in radial flow sedimentation tanks in wastewater treatment projects, especially in secondary sedimentation tanks, for scraping and discharging the sludge from the bottom of the tanks. The tank shape typically adopts a central inlet and peripheral outlet design. Pump-driven sludge removal. A flat-bottom structure can be adopted for the tank bottom. The scum, foam, and other debris on the water surface can be scraped and discharged to the outside of the tank, scum pit, or scum bucket by the scum scraping device.
The machine mainly consists of a main beam (truss or folded-plate beam), overflow weir, transmission device, flow stabilizer, sludge suction device, sludge discharge chute, scraper, scum collection and sludge discharge facilities, and power transmission equipment.
Scraping: The V-shaped scrapers on the machine collect the sludge that settles on the tank bottom.
Suction: The collected sludge is then sucked into the suction pipe by the suction system.
Discharge: The sludge and water mixture is transported through the system (typically by siphon or pump) to a separate tank or area for further treatment.
Scum Removal (Optional): Some machines are equipped with a skimmer to remove scum from the water surface and direct it to the scum tank.
Key Components
Working Bridge/Main Girder: This is the structural component that spans the water tank.
Drive Track: This is the mechanism that allows the bridge to move along the tracks on the surface of the water tank.
Slurry Suction System: This consists of pipes and pumps that suck up the sludge and water mixture.
V-Scraper: This is a tool that directs settled sludge into the suction pipe.
Skimming Device: This is an optional component used to remove floating debris from the water surface.
Electrical Control Cabinet: This controls the operation of the machine.
Applications
Wastewater Treatment Plant: This is used to remove settled sludge and flocculants from sedimentation tanks.
Horizontal Sedimentation Tanks: This is used in various industrial and municipal wastewater treatment applications.
Stormwater Drains and Septic Tanks: Specialized water suction machines are used to clean these systems.
